This book is an introduction to waste water and cooling water treatments for student and graduate engineers in the oil industry. It is based on industrial implementation of these treatments and describes the experience gained by a number of plant managers in operating their own facilities. The challenge for both effluent purification and cooling water conditioning is the search for minimum makeup water consumption and consequently optimum effluent recovery in order to ensure better environmental protection.Contents: 1.
